Webb23 aug. 2024 · Some of the books written on Kashmir by authors, indigenous and foreign, are: 1. The Rage of the Vulture (1948) by Alan Moorehead. Of all the fictional accounts of Kashmir in 1947, this little known novel by Alan Moorehead has the ‘greatest’ historical interest. For a start, Moorehead was there – he reported from Kashmir and from the ... WebbK File is an informative and impressive account of Kashmir and Kashmiris. Webb20 juni 2013 · A.G. Noorani. The Kashmir Dispute 1947–2012 is a book in two volumes which traces the complex history of the long-standing dispute, and the political discontent and dissent surrounding it – relating especially to the question of the accession of the state of Jammu & Kashmir to the Union of India.
